SmartFusion2 MSS GPIO Konfigirasyon
Manyèl itilizatè
Entwodiksyon
SmartFusion2 Microcontroller Subsystem (MSS) bay yon sèl GPIO periferik difisil (APB_1 otobis sub) ki sipòte 32 I/O pou objektif jeneral.
Sou twal MSS la, ou dwe aktive (default) oswa enfim egzanp GPIO selon si wi ou non yo te itilize li nan aplikasyon ou ye kounye a. Si li enfim, egzanp GPIO la kenbe nan reset (eta pouvwa ki pi ba). Pa default, pa gen okenn GPIO itilize lè ou aktive egzanp GPIO la premye fwa. Remake byen ke MSIO yo atribye ba egzanp GPIO yo pataje ak lòt periferik MSS. I/O pataje sa yo disponib pou konekte lòt periferik lè egzanp GPIO la enfim oswa si pò egzanp GPIO yo konekte ak twal FPGA la. Remake byen ke GPIO yo konfigirasyon endividyèlman nan konfigirasyon periferik GPIO la. Konpòtman fonksyonèl chak GPIO (sa vle di konpòtman entèwonp) dwe defini nan nivo aplikasyon an lè l sèvi avèk SmartFusion2 MSS MMUART Driver Microsemi bay. Nan dokiman sa a, nou dekri kijan pou w konfigirasyon ka MSS GPIO yo epi defini kijan siyal periferik yo konekte. Pou plis detay sou periferik difisil MSS GPIO yo, tanpri al gade Gid Itilizatè SmartFusion2 la
Opsyon Konfigirasyon
Definisyon Set/Reset – Gen kat gwoup egal uit GPIO yo chak pou yon total de 32. Ou ka defini yon sous komen ak eta (Mete oswa Reset) pou uit GPIO yo nan yon gwoup. Gen de chwa pou sous Mete/Reset:
- Anrejistre Sistèm - Chak gwoup gen yon enskri sistèm inik pou objektif sa a. Ou ka jwenn aksè nan anrejistreman sistèm yo atravè firmwèr. Mete MSS_GPIO_ la _SOFT_RESET enskri sistèm pral reset tout GPIO yo nan ranje sa a nan valè a defini nan eta a reset.
- Twal FPGA - Siyal la rele MSS_GPIO_RESET_N.
Figi 1-1 Opsyon Konfigirasyon SmartFusion2 MSS GPIO
Tablo plasman siyal GPIO
Achitekti SmartFusion2 bay yon chema trè fleksib pou konekte siyal periferik yo swa MSIO oswa twal FPGA. Sèvi ak tablo konfigirasyon siyal plasman an pou defini ak kisa periferik ou konekte nan aplikasyon w lan. Tablo devwa sa a gen kolòn sa yo:
GPIO ID - Idantifye idantifyan GPIO - 0 a 31 - pou chak ranje.
Direksyon – Endike si GPIO a configuré kòm Antre, Sòti, Tristate oswa Bidirectionnelle. Sèvi ak pulldown la pou mete direksyon GPIO la.
PIN pake - Montre peny pake ki asosye ak MSIO a lè siyal la konekte ak yon MSIO.
Koneksyon – Sèvi ak lis drop-down pou chwazi si siyal la konekte ak yon MSIO oswa twal FPGA. Gen de opsyon - A ak B -, nan chak ka, ke ou ka chwazi nan.
MSIO – Gen de diferan devwa I/O posib pou chak
GPIO: IO_A ak IO_B. Ou ka chwazi swa epi tcheke peny pake a. Yon ti konsèy sou pin pakè a endike ki lòt periferik ta ka itilize menm MSIO la tou. Ou ka itilize opsyon IO_A ak IO_B pou rezoud konfli. Pou egzanp, nan IO_A deja itilize pa yon lòt periferik, ou ka chwazi IO_B. Nan kèk konbinezon aparèy/pake, tou de opsyon IO_A ak/oswa IO_B ka pa disponib.
FPGA twal – Gen de devwa diferan posib pou chak GPIO nan twal FPGA la: – Fabric_A ak Fabric_B. Ou ka itilize opsyon Fabric_A ak Fabric_B pou rezoud konfli. Pou egzanp, nan Fabric_A deja itilize pa yon lòt periferik, ou ka chwazi Fabric_B. Nan kèk aparèy, tou de opsyon Fabric_A ak/oswa Fabric_B ka pa disponib. Koneksyon Siplemantè - Sèvi ak kaz Opsyon Avanse pou view opsyon koneksyon siplemantè yo:
- Tcheke opsyon twal la pou obsève nan twal FPGA yon siyal ki konekte ak yon MSIO.
Koneksyon Preview
Koneksyon an Preview panèl nan dyalòg la MSS GPIO Configurator montre yon grafik view nan koneksyon aktyèl yo pou ranje a siyal make (Figi 3-1).
Figi 3-1 Koneksyon Preview Panel
Konfli Resous
Paske periferik MSS - MMUART, I2C, SPI, CAN, GPIO, USB ak Ethernet MAC - pataje resous aksè MSIO ak FPGA twal, konfigirasyon nenpòt nan periferik sa yo ka lakòz yon konfli resous lè ou configured yon egzanp nan periferik aktyèl la. . Konfigirateur periferik bay endikatè klè lè yon konfli konsa rive.
Resous yo itilize pa yon periferik konfigirasyon deja bay twa kalite fidbak nan konfigirateur periferik aktyèl la:
Enfòmasyon – Si yon resous itilize pa yon lòt periferik pa konfli ak konfigirasyon aktyèl la, yon icon enfòmasyon ap parèt, nan Koneksyon Pre a.view panèl, sou resous sa a. Yon konsèy sou ikòn bay detay sou ki periferik ki sèvi ak resous sa a.
Avètisman/Erè - Si yon resous yon lòt periferik itilize konfli ak konfigirasyon aktyèl la, yon icon avètisman oswa erè parèt, nan Koneksyon Pre.view panèl, sou resous sa a. Yon konsèy sou ikòn bay detay sou ki periferik ki sèvi ak resous sa a. Lè erè yo parèt ou pa ka komèt konfigirasyon aktyèl la. Y
Ou ka swa rezoud konfli a lè w sèvi ak yon konfigirasyon diferan oswa anile konfigirasyon aktyèl la lè l sèvi avèk bouton an Anile. Lè avètisman yo parèt (e pa gen okenn erè), ou ka komèt konfigirasyon aktyèl la. Sepandan, ou pa ka jenere MSS an jeneral; ou pral wè erè jenerasyon yo nan fenèt Log Libero SoC. Ou dwe rezoud konfli a ke ou te kreye lè ou te komèt konfigirasyon an pa rekonfigire youn nan periferik ki lakòz konfli a. Konfiguratè periferik yo aplike règ sa yo pou detèmine si yo ta dwe rapòte yon konfli kòm yon erè oswa yon avètisman.
- Si periferik ke yo te configuré a se periferik GPIO, tout konfli yo se erè.
- Si periferik ke yo te konfigirasyon an se pa periferik GPIO, lè sa a tout konfli yo se erè sof si konfli a se ak yon resous GPIO nan ka sa a konfli yo pral trete kòm avètisman.
Erè Feedback Egzample
Yo itilize periferik I2C_1 epi li sèvi ak aparèy PAD ki limite ak pake PIN V23. Konfigirasyon periferik GPIO (GPIO_0) konsa ke pò GPIO_0 konekte ak yon MSIO rezilta nan yon erè. Figi 4-1 montre icon erè ki parèt nan tablo asiyasyon koneksyon pou pò GPIO_0 la.
Figi 4-1 Erè ki parèt nan Tablo devwa Koneksyon an
Figi 4-2 montre icon erè ki parèt nan pre aview panèl sou resous PAD pou pò GPIO_0 la.
Figi 4-2 Erè ki parèt nan Preview Panel
Enfòmasyon Feedback Egzample
Yo itilize periferik I2C_1 epi li sèvi ak aparèy PAD ki limite ak pake PIN V23. Konfigirasyon periferik GPIO la konsa ke pò GPIO_0 konekte ak twal FPGA la pa lakòz yon konfli. Sepandan, pou endike ke li PAD ki asosye ak pò GPIO_0 a (men li pa itilize nan ka sa a), ikòn Enfòmasyon an parèt nan pre a.view panèl (Figi 4-3). Yon ti konsèy ki asosye ak icon nan bay yon deskripsyon sou fason yo itilize resous la (I2C_1 nan ka sa a).
Figi 4-3 Icône enfòmasyon nan Preview Panel
Deskripsyon Port
Tablo 5-1 Deskripsyon pò GPIO
Non Port | Gwoup Port | Deskripsyon |
GPIO_ | GPIO_PADS/GPIO_FABRIC | GPIO siyal |
Nòt:
- Non pò I/O 'koneksyon prensipal' yo gen IN, OUT, TRI oswa BI kòm yon sifiks ki baze sou direksyon yo chwazi a, egzanp GPIO_0_IN.
- Twal 'koneksyon prensipal' pò antre non yo gen "F2M" kòm yon sifiks, egzanp GPIO _8_F2M. • Twal 'koneksyon siplemantè' non pò antre yo gen "I2F" kòm yon sifiks, egzanp GPIO_8_I2F.
- Non pwodiksyon twal ak pwodiksyon-pèmèt pò yo gen "M2F" ak "M2F_OE" kòm yon sifiks, egzanp GPIO_8_M2F ak GPIO_ 8_M2F_OE. • Pò PAD yo otomatikman monte nan tèt nan yerachi konsepsyon an.
A - Sipò pou pwodwi
Microsemi SoC Products Group apiye pwodwi li yo ak divès kalite sèvis sipò, tankou Sèvis Kliyan, Sant Sipò Teknik Kliyan, yon websit, lapòs elektwonik, ak biwo lavant atravè lemond. Anèks sa a gen enfòmasyon sou kontakte Microsemi SoC Products Group epi itilize sèvis sipò sa yo.
Sèvis Kliyan
Kontakte Sèvis Kliyan pou sipò pwodwi ki pa teknik, tankou pri pwodwi, amelyorasyon pwodwi, enfòmasyon aktyalizasyon, estati lòd, ak otorizasyon.
Soti nan Amerik di Nò, rele 800.262.1060
Soti nan rès mond lan, rele 650.318.4460
Fakse, nenpòt kote nan mond lan, 408.643.6913
Sant sipò teknik pou kliyan
Microsemi SoC Products Group bay Sant Sipò Teknik Kliyan li a ak enjenyè ki gen anpil ladrès ki ka ede reponn kesyon pyès ki nan konpitè, lojisyèl, ak konsepsyon ou sou pwodwi Microsemi SoC. Sant Sipò Teknik Kliyan an pase anpil tan pou kreye nòt aplikasyon, repons pou kesyon sik konsepsyon komen yo, dokimantasyon sou pwoblèm li te ye, ak plizyè FAQ. Se konsa, anvan ou kontakte nou, tanpri vizite resous sou entènèt nou yo. Li trè posib nou te deja reponn kesyon ou yo.
Sipò teknik
Vizite Sipò Kliyan an websit (www.microsemi.com/soc/support/search/default.aspx) pou plis enfòmasyon ak sipò. Anpil repons disponib sou rechèch la web resous gen ladan dyagram, ilistrasyon, ak lyen ki mennen nan lòt resous sou la websit.
Websit
Ou ka browse yon varyete enfòmasyon teknik ak enfòmasyon ki pa teknik sou paj lakay SoC, nan www.microsemi.com/soc.
Kontakte Sant Sipò Teknik Kliyan an
Enjenyè trè kalifye anplwaye Sant Sipò Teknik la. Ou ka kontakte Sant Sipò Teknik la pa imèl oswa atravè Microsemi SoC Products Group la websit.
Imèl
Ou ka kominike kesyon teknik ou yo nan adrès imel nou an epi resevwa repons pa imel, faks, oswa telefòn. Epitou, si ou gen pwoblèm konsepsyon, ou ka imèl esign ou files pou resevwa asistans. Nou toujou ap kontwole kont imel la pandan tout jounen an. Lè w ap voye demann ou an ba nou, tanpri asire w ke w mete non konplè w, non konpayi w, ak enfòmasyon kontak w pou w ka trete demann ou an efikas. Adrès imel sipò teknik la se soc_tech@microsemi.com.
Ka mwen yo
Kliyan Microsemi SoC Products Group ka soumèt epi swiv ka teknik yo sou Entènèt lè yo ale nan Ka mwen yo.
Deyò peyi Etazini
Kliyan ki bezwen asistans deyò zòn lè Etazini yo ka swa kontakte sipò teknik pa imel (soc_tech@microsemi.com) oswa kontakte yon biwo lavant lokal. Ou ka jwenn lis biwo lavant yo nan www.microsemi.com/soc/company/contact/default.aspx.
Sipò teknik ITAR
Pou sipò teknik sou FPGA RH ak RT ki reglemante pa Règleman Trafik Entènasyonal nan Zam (ITAR), kontakte nou via soc_tech_itar@microsemi.com. Altènativman, nan Ka mwen yo, chwazi Wi nan lis deroulant ITAR la. Pou jwenn yon lis konplè Microsemi FPGA ki reglemante ITAR, vizite ITAR la web paj.
Microsemi Corporation (NASDAQ: MSCC) ofri yon dosye konplè nan solisyon semi-conducteurs pou: ayewospasyal, defans ak sekirite; antrepriz ak kominikasyon; ak mache enèji endistriyèl ak altènatif. Pwodwi yo gen ladan aparèy analòg ak RF wo-pèfòmans, segondè fyab, siyal melanje ak sikwi entegre RF, SoCs customizable, FPGA, ak subsystems konplè. Microsemi gen biwo santral li nan Aliso Viejo, Kalifòni. Aprann plis nan www.microsemi.com.
© 2012 Microsemi Corporation. Tout dwa rezève. Microsemi ak logo Microsemi a se mak komèsyal Microsemi Corporation. Tout lòt mak komèsyal ak mak sèvis yo se pwopriyete pwopriyetè respektif yo.
Katye Jeneral Microsemi Corporate
One Enterprise, Aliso Viejo CA 92656 USA
Nan peyi Etazini: +1 949-380-6100
Komèsyal: +1 949-380-6136
Faks: +1 949-215-4996
Dokiman / Resous
![]() |
Microsemi SmartFusion2 MSS GPIO Konfigirasyon [pdfManyèl Itilizatè SmartFusion2 MSS GPIO Konfigirasyon, SmartFusion2 MSS, GPIO Konfigirasyon, Konfigirasyon |